Output 24d95ea96b92c8d888ac726fc8f20bbe54656d5d267e1694def0cee31abf57d4:6

value
55844754
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b8f2c6ddad0291125081c3fd6bf94fe3ca30d664 OP_EQUALVERIFY OP_CHECKSIG
address
Lc5sRwR1RryoPBgjhcRDAhJAGEAuqnsPtk
transaction
24d95ea96b92c8d888ac726fc8f20bbe54656d5d267e1694def0cee31abf57d4
spent
true